Basketball Recap: Julian Jaguars vs. Cahokia Comanches
Julian fought the good fight in their overtime contest against Cahokia on Tuesday but wound up with a less-than-desirable result. They took a 74-61 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Comanches. The Jaguars have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
When it comes to explaining why Julian lost, don't look at Will Chapman. Despite the final result, he posted 17 points and six rebounds. Another player making a difference was Malakhi Calahan, who earned eight points.
Cahokia was led to victory by Zetaveyon Grant and Corrion Raiford. Grant made all 7 shots he took for 16 points, while Raiford went 7-for-9 to rack up 15 points and seven boards. What's more, Raiford also posted a 78% field goal percentage, which is the highest he's achieved since back in January. Taven Miller was another key player, putting up 16 points.
Julian's defeat dropped their record down to 4-7. As for Cahokia, with the victory, they broke their five-game losing streak and moved their record to 3-7.
Julian has already played their next matchup, a 73-50 win against Sumner/Northwest Academy of Law on the 31st. As for Cahokia, they also did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next game, a 59-45 loss against Southridge on the 31st.
